 Training

At Tshivingwi Bush Experiences, the trainers aim to promote an extremely high standard of training accredited with the relevant bodies, (FGASA, THETA, ETDP) and is based on 12 years of experience as a guides.

Our courses are based on the FGASA syllabus and all evaluations, material and training are quality assured by the FGASA, CEO (Grant Hine), a training and evaluation sub committee, and are accredited by THETA and ETDP.

Tshivingwi currently operates in the Greater Kruger National Park, Madikwe, Waterberg and Northern regions of Kwa-Zulu Natal and will soon be expanding into other regions including Mozambique, Zambia, Botswana and Namibia. We encourage all guides to conduct themselves in an ethical, sensitive and professional manner so as to ensure that guests enjoy a valuable, safe and memorable experience. The purpose of which should be to ensure that conservation and tourism remain sustainable so that future generations may appreciate our natural heritage that we should be preserving for them.

Tshivingwi currently offers the following courses:

  Introduction to Nature Guiding ( FGASA level l & ll Preparation Courses - 1 to 2 Weeks )
  FGASA level lll Preparation Courses
  FGASA Accredited Advanced Rifle Handling Course & Evaluation
  Specialist Tracking and Sign Interpretation Courses
  Correspondence Courses for FGASA Level I, II, & III
  FGASA Level l, ll, lll, & SKS (Dangerous Animals) Evaluations
  Tracker Assessments, Developmental Training and Evaluations
  THETA Nature Unit Assessments (NQF2, NQF3, NQF4, NQF6) with a view of potentially dangerous animals

Subject Summary:

(click + for more details)

 

+ Nature Guide Code of Conduct and Etiquette

A summary of the ethical and operational requirements of a guide specifically guiding procedures during game drives and trails in areas where dangerous animals occur.

+ Geology and Geomorphology

Explores the basic geology and geological history, major rock divisions, major minerals, plate tectonics, related soils, characteristics, soil profiles, weathering and erosion, etc. of South Africa.
